How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Delaplane?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Delaplane Studio Apartments | $1,864 | $1,100 | $4,238 |
Delaplane 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,883 | $500 | $4,357 |
Delaplane 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,071 | $550 | $5,449 |
Delaplane 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,056 | $1,360 | $3,748 |
Delaplane 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,400 | $2,400 | $2,400 |
